£95m London Housing Scheme Reaches Demolition Stage

The £95 million Park East redevelopment in Erith, London, has taken a major step forward with a key project milestone.

Demolition has begun on the site, which will see developers Wates Residential and Orbit deliver 320 new homes. When complete, 80 per cent of the homes will for affordable rent and shared ownership to ensure a mixed, aspirational and sustainable community for local residents.

Team members from both organisations came together with guests from the London Borough of Bexley and former residents at a special demolition event on Wednesday 27 November to mark the significant step forward for the project.

A large focus has also been put on kick starting training opportunities from local residents by hiring at least 31 apprentices and at least 25 people in full time employment from the local area. Wates has also brought its Building Futures programme, which helps unemployed adults gain valuable practical experience and employability coaching to reinvigorate their career prospects.

Glen Roberts, Operations Director for Wates Residential, said: "The start of demolition is a significant moment for the Park East development, which will deliver hundreds of high quality new homes and a lasting legacy for the area.

"We are pleased to have been able to join together with our partners Orbit and the London Borough of Bexley to hear from residents about their fondest memories of the area. We are looking forward to the community being able to make new memories in Park East over the coming years."

Work is expected to be completed by 2023.
